Airport Overview
The Crete Island, Greece region is served by Tympaki Air Base (LGTY), a public-use airport at 7 feet elevation. The airfield offers 1 runway(s) — 8,900 feet on the primary strip — for private and corporate traffic. Runway Capability
With 8900 feet of runway, Tympaki Air Base accommodates the full spectrum of business aviation aircraft. Light jets, midsize jets, super-mids, and heavy jets (including Gulfstream G650, Global 7500, and Boeing BBJ) can operate from LGTY under standard conditions. Long runway availability also provides comfortable safety margins for hot-day and high-gross-weight departures.
Charter Considerations
When chartering from Tympaki Air Base, consider the round-trip economics. One-way charters incur a repositioning fee (the empty leg back to base). Round-trips from LGTY eliminate this cost.
